Back from the break and we see a video package on recent events between Otis and Mandy Rose, including how Otis was brokenhearted after showing up to their Valentine’s Day date to see Dolph Ziggler standing at their table with Rose. Rose and Sonya Deville are backstage talking now when Tucker walks up. He says Rose hurt his boy. She says this is not the time. He just wants to talk. Tucker says Rose agreed to go with Otis on a date and then she invited Ziggler. He talks about how rough Otis is taking it. She says she invited Ziggler when Otis didn’t show up. Tucker asks why then did she send a text message saying she was running late. Rose is confused about that and it seems she didn’t send the text. Maybe Ziggler set Otis up? Tucker goes on about how sweet Otis is and then has some tense words for Rose. He walks off. Sonya says maybe Mandy dodged a bullet because she did have fun with Ziggler. Rose says yes but she was kind of looking forward to going out with Otis, but oh well. Deville says Ziggler is more like Rose’s type anyway. Rose might not be so sure of that.
The screen flickers some more as we see Mandy Rose backstage waiting for her car to pick her up. Dolph Ziggler walks up and offers her a ride as he has his car with him tonight. Mandy says sure and leaves with Ziggler. We see Otis emerge from behind a stack of production cases, apparently he was watching Rose. Otis looks angry as we go back to commercial.
